Institution Berkeley College
Position Title Dean of Students
Job Location New York City, NY
Description The Dean of Students for the New York City campuses will lead a team responsible for the oversight of residential life, judicial affairs, orientation, commencement, counseling services, student activities, and leadership development. This appointment will provide a unique opportunity to influence the student experience at Berkeley College by meeting the needs of a diverse campus population, fostering student development and promoting involvement in campus life; the individual must have strong commitment to student success and student centered service.


Knowledge, Skills & Abilities: Knowledge of best practices in higher educational administration and leadership, student personnel services, student development theory and student learning outcomes; knowledge and demonstrated effective management experience of report areas in student affairs including leadership development, conflict resolution, assessment, and staff development; demonstrated experience in strategic planning, goal development and outcomes assessment, consultative and collaborative decision making; demonstrated effectiveness in managing more than one area of student affairs including residential and co-curricular learning programs in a multicultural environment.


Qualifications: Doctorate preferred; a master's degree in higher education, student affairs or related applicable degree from an accredited college or university and 10 plus years of increasing management experience (including at least three years as an Assistant or Associate Dean) in Student Affairs.
